We are currently in need of an Events and Programming Supervisor, who will supervise and direct a broad program of activities and services offered countywide and at BWA parks; ensure facilities are well-maintained and safe, and coordinate any concerns in the unit.     In this role, you will...

    Event Management and Program Delivery

    + Innovatively plans, develops, implements, promotes, and directs a broad program of activities, programs, and services offered Countywide and at BWA parks.

    + Maintains effective relations with a variety of community organizations, groups, and the public.

    + Works closely with County staff to provide comprehensive recreation services to County residents and to solve a broad range of service delivery, community, and administrative problems.

    + Serves as a liaison to the BWA Division Management Team and makes recommendations on recreation services, staffing, and procedures.

    + Handles citizen complaints and explains County ordinances, policies, and procedures. Function as a liaison with various user groups and organizations.

    + Plans, organizes, assigns, supervises, reviews, and evaluates the work of assigned staff. Contributes to the efficiency and effectiveness of services to customers by offering suggestions and direction or by participating as an active member of the assigned work team.

    + Surveys and communicates with the community to determine recreation needs and implements programs to satisfy those needs as appropriate.

    + Orders materials, supplies, and equipment; prepares work orders for the accomplishment of maintenance needs.

    + Coordinates any maintenance concerns in the division through various departments and divisions.

    Operational Management

    + Assist in the development and direct the implementation of goals, objectives, policies, and work standards for assigned events and programs.

    + Lead and/or assist in the operational needs in the field associated with events and programming to include but not limited to set-up, during event operation, and demobilization.

    + Assist in the preparation of the annual budget; Assists in administering the budget for accounts directly related to assigned areas or activities. Assists with contract management.

    + Prepares a variety of periodic and special reports related to recreation programs, facilities, revenue, expenditures, and recreation data collection.

    + Develops and writes procedures and manuals. Ensures compliance to county guidelines, policies and procedures

    + Ensure proper implementation of pricing plan. Monitors account receivables.

    + Assists with attaining and maintaining CAPRA accreditation for PRNR.

    + Manages, directs, coaches, mentors, trains, evaluates, disciplines and supervises direct staff. Ensures the proper supervision, training, coaching, and evaluation for subordinate staff. Promotes a positive culture within the organization through clear communication.

    + Works with the BWA team as the coordinator for volunteer program. Provides oversight and direction for all volunteer efforts.

    About You

    Minimum Qualifications:

    + A Bachelor’s Degree in Recreation, Leisure Services, Education, Public Administration, Business Administration, or a closely related field.

    + Progressively responsible professional experience as described herein can substitute on a year-for-year basis for the required college education.

    + Two years minimum supervisory experience; Two years minimum experience with conducting or overseeing programming from facility programs to large special events for the community

    Preferred Qualifications:

    + Experience with cash handling from receipt to reconciliation and deposits.

    + Certified Parks and Recreation Professional (CPRP).

    + Experience with Rectrac registration software. Experience with Smartsheet.
